TY - JOUR TT - STOCHASTIC CONVERGENCE OF PER CAPITA GREENHOUSE GAS EMISSIONS AMONG G7 COUNTRIES: AN EVIDENCE FROM STRUCTURAL BREAKS AU - Kıran Baygın, Burcu PY - 2017 DA - August JF - Istanbul University Econometrics and Statistics e-Journal PB - Istanbul University WT - DergiPark SN - 1308-7215 SP - 60 EP - 70 IS - 26 KW - Stochastic convergence KW - divergence KW - greenhouse gas emissions KW - unit root KW - structural breaks N2 - This paper tests the stochasticconvergence hypothesis of per capita greenhouse gas emissions among G7countries over the period from 1990 through 2014. In testing stochasticconvergence, we transfer per capita greenhouse gas emissions in level, relativeto the average by using methodology of Carlino and Mills (1993, 1996) andinvestigate unit root properties of these obtained relative series by usingrecently developed unit root test of Narayan and Popp(2010) besidesconventional unit root tests. Conventional unit root test results indicate thatstochastic convergence hypothesis is supported only for France and UnitedStates. On the other hand, when we take into account existence of possiblestructural breaks, the results provide significant support for stochasticconvergence of relative per capita greenhouse gas emissions for France, Japan,United Kingdom and United States and divergence for Canada, Germany and Italy.
